WebMar 4, 2024 · Hot Dip Galvanization. Hot dip galvanization requires raw metal to be cleaned in a caustic solution to remove impurities and scale on the surface. The material is rinsed and a non-oxidizing flux compound is applied. The metal is immersed in a molten zinc bath at a temperature between 443 to 465 degrees Celsius (830 to 870 degrees Fahrenheit).
